For the weekly sync: the Meridian two-way calendar sync hit a conflict storm last week when the Tallow tenant's connector replayed stale events, locking the sync service account after repeated auth failures. While locked, conflicts queue but do not resolve; users see duplicate events. Recovery: pause the connector, drain the conflict queue to the holding table, then unlock the account through the offline console. Do not restart the connector before unlock completes. The console requires the recovery passphrase recorded immediately below.

unlock words, tawep-fahog: casir-kasion-rusius-silael-ralax-frair-belius-quenmir-oliix-quenir-gorwyn-praion-casion-wenix

Document Transport — Print Shop Master Copies

Quick guide for moving master copies to Bramblehurst Print Co. These are the only originals, so treat the run like a valuables transfer, not a regular parcel drop. Use the red tamper-evident envelopes from the supply shelf, log the seal number in the transport book, and never combine the run with general mail. The masters go directly to the press supervisor, nobody else. On arrival, the courier must follow the hand-over instruction stated below.

drop instructions, kajep-tageg: the kasvan casdor courier leaves the quenvan quenox druox ledger at gate 4316 under passcode 799004

- [ ] Validate the Pixelforge CLI's batch resize mode before tagging the release. As a new contractor, note: run the fixture set in assets/golden, confirm output dimensions match the manifest exactly, and check that EXIF rotation is preserved — this regressed twice last quarter. Flag any checksum drift to the team lead. The build under test is identified by the token below.

trace token, tawep-fahif: htk3_b58

TURN-208: Gatevale turnstile counters at the Merrow Field pilot double-count when a rotation reverses mid-cycle. Attendance totals drift roughly 2% high per event. The debounce window fix is implemented, reviewed by Ilsa, and soak-tested across two simulated match days without drift. Ready for your cut; the candidate build is identified below.

trace token, tagag-tafog: htk6_5ed18c